Recite Meaning in Bengali

In Bengali, the word “recite” translates to “আবৃত্তি করা” (pronounced “abritti kora”). This translation encompasses the core meaning of “recite,” which is to repeat aloud from memory, often with a focus on formal or artistic expression.

Recite অর্থ কী?

“Recite” শব্দটির বাংলায় অর্থ হলো “আবৃত্তি করা” (abritti kora)। এর অর্থ হলো মুখস্থ কিছু আওড়ানো, বিশেষ করে কবিতা, গান, ধর্মীয় বা আইনগত বিষয়বস্তু। এটি একটি সুন্দর এবং আনুষ্ঠানিক উপায়ে উপস্থাপনের জন্য ব্যবহৃত হয়।

Examples

  • Poetry Recitation: A student might recite a poem by Rabindranath Tagore during a school event.
  • Religious Recitation: Devotees often recite prayers or verses from holy texts.
  • Legal Recitation: A lawyer might recite relevant sections of the law during a court case.
  • Memorization: Actors recite their lines to perfect their performance.

Synonyms

  • Repeat: To say or do something again.
  • Declaim: To speak rhetorically or passionately.
  • Rehearse: To practice for a performance.
  • Deliver: To present something formally.

Antonyms

  • Improvise: To create something spontaneously.
  • Mumble: To speak indistinctly.
  • Forget: To be unable to remember.

Phrases and Idioms

  • Recite by rote: To repeat something mechanically without understanding.
  • Recite chapter and verse: To quote something exactly.
  • Recite one’s grievances: To list complaints or problems.

Uses

The word “recite” finds its way into various domains:

  • Education: Students recite multiplication tables or historical facts.
  • Literature: Poets recite their works at readings or gatherings.
  • Religion: Rituals often involve the recitation of sacred texts.
  • Law: Legal proceedings may include the recitation of legal codes.
